    • In recent years, the US has seen a surge in demand for term life insurance policies, particularly among individuals and families seeking budget-friendly options. One of the primary drivers of this trend is the growing awareness of the importance of having adequate life insurance coverage, even on a limited budget. With the cost of living increasing and financial stability a top concern, many Americans are searching for affordable term life insurance policies to protect their loved ones and ensure their financial well-being.
